Dorami-chan: Mini-Dora SOS!!! (ドラミちゃん ミニドラSOS!!!, Dorami-chan: Mini-Dora SOS!!!) is a 1989 Japanese animated science fiction comedy-drama short film.[1] It premiered in Japan on March 11, 1989[1] on a double feature with Doraemon: Nobita and the Birth of Japan.
The film's tagline is "Dorami-chan's first starring movie role!! A Doramitic adventure unfolding in the world of the 21st century!!"

The short is notably one of the only pieces of Doraemon media where Doraemon himself does not appear, only making a cameo in the photographs seen inside Nobita's family photo album.
Production
It was produced as a concurrent film alongside Doraemon: Nobita and the Birth of Japan. It is the first installment of the Dorami-chan short films and the work that made the character of Mini-Dora famous.
According to Fujiko F. Fujio, because Dorami had very few chances to appear and shine in the Doraemon manga, he felt bad for the fans, so by the time the 10th anniversary of the Doraemon feature films had started, the idea to make a film starring Dorami came up, leading to the beginning of production.[2]
Before creating a summary of the film's story, a meeting was held where the film's director Makoto Moriwaki and other animation staff shared many of their own ideas. Fujiko F. Fujio gave feedback in order to shape the story direction, with the "submarine ranch" featured in the story being an idea of his.[3]
